How can we avoid a catastrophic comet?
There are several ways of trying to deflect an on-coming asteroid. The first is to try the “ Hollywood approach ” and simply blow it up!
However, in spite of the possibly spectacular visuals that could result from “nuking it”, the shattered asteroid could merely become a swarm of slightly smaller and still very destructive space rocks heading towards our planet.
Really, this would only be considered at a very, very last resort.
Another way would be to just give the asteroid a nudge, to change its path away from the Earth.
Knocking it with some sort of impact could do this. Or maybe an unmanned spacecraft with enough mass could be put in orbit about the asteroid to effectively change the “gravitational pull” and alter the trajectory that way.
Orbiting around and landing on a comet may seem like the stuff of Star Trek.
However this was actually achieved in 2014 by the European Space Agency’s Rosetta space craft which also sent a small lander called Philae down to the comet’s surface. However, Rosetta took a decade to get to its comet destination.
So if the the asteroid encounters needed to deflect a Earth directed impact are to be effective, the asteroid would need to be detected many years in advance and shoved or pulled many million of kilometers from Earth

A nuclear weapon would be much more effective. This is because of physics. Nuclear weapons put out the most energy per pound of virtually anything. The goal would be to alter the asteroid's course, not obliterate it, and nuclear weapons are the best choice for this due to insanely large amount of force they can apply relative to the cost of lifting them into space. If the human race was in danger and money was no object, we could easily lift several thousand nuclear weapons into space to alter the trajectory of even the largest asteroids.
